Laios: The Curious and Calculated Frontliner
Laios, a 5-star melee unit, falls under the Dreadnought Guard category, renowned for their potent single-target damage. However, Laios stands out due to his unique mechanics that reward players for strategic foresight and adaptability. He excels when deployed with consideration of enemy types and spawn patterns, making him a perfect fit for those who enjoy meticulous planning.
Marcille: The Versatile Mage with Team Synergy
Marcille, a 5-star caster, introduces dynamic gameplay centered around mana management and team synergy. At Elite 2, she gains the talent "Reliable Companion," which not only boosts her initial mana to 25 but also enhances the entire team's Attack Speed (ASPD) and Defense (DEF) when four or more Laios’s Party members are present. This talent significantly bolsters both offensive and defensive capabilities.
Skills and Combat Use
Marcille's three skills cater to different tactical needs, each influenced by your mana management:
- A Top Student’s Abilities: A burst skill that amplifies Marcille's attack or heals allies if no enemies are nearby, making it versatile for various scenarios.
- Summon Familiar: This skill summons a companion that enhances Marcille's basic attacks with slow effects. It can be reactivated to further upgrade the familiar, extending range and adding a stun effect, perfect for crowd control.
- Explosion Magic: A high-mana skill culminating in a massive Area of Effect (AoE) explosion with a stun effect. Continuous chanting and additional mana investment can transform this into a multi-hit attack, ideal for clearing waves swiftly.
Marcille's effectiveness hinges on timing her deployment and skill usage optimally, often requiring her to retreat and recharge mana after engaging.
Building and Synergy
Reaching Elite 2 is pivotal for Marcille, unlocking her full potential and team synergy. Prioritize upgrading "Summon Familiar" for its versatility across different stages, while "Explosion Magic" serves well for scenarios requiring high burst damage.
Recommended Development Path:
- Promotion Priority: Elite 2 for enhanced mana scaling and team support.
- Skill Upgrade Focus: "Summon Familiar" for utility; "Explosion Magic" for burst damage.
- Best Potentials: Focus on increasing ATK and reducing redeployment time.
Marcille synergizes well with operators that enhance her safety during chanting or indirectly boost her Skill Points (SP). She complements Laios and other Laios’s Party members, benefiting from the team-wide buffs, and also fits into caster-focused compositions needing both damage and control.
